There appears to have been various changes made since 0.9.32 that assume DL_LOADADDR_TYPE is always a scalar, which isn't the case for fdpic.

For instance:
dl-startup.c(DL_START) at line 281 checks:
if(load_addr)

Further on at line 350, it casts a scalar to DL_LOADADDR_TYPE:
_dl_get_ready_to_run(tpnt, (DL_LOADADDR_TYPE) header, auxvt, envp, argv DL_GET_READY_TO_RUN_EXTRA_ARGS);

There's other similar changes in other files, these are just two examples.  Am I missing something obvious here or do these changes not make sense for fdpic?
